Thanksgiving Break and Hybrid Schedule

Just a reminder that Thanksgiving break will be Wednesday, November 25th through Friday, November 27th and there will be no school for students. For hybrid learning that week, Monday, November 23rd will be an “A” day for students to report in person. Tuesday, November 24th will be a “B” day for students to report in person.

Outdoor Recess

With a return to cooler temperatures, please remember to send your child to school with appropriate outdoor attire for recess. We are working hard to go out to recess daily, especially as it allows for a time that our students can take a socially distanced mask break. Our recesses are 30 minutes in length this year so it is important that our students be comfortable while they are outside.
